## ParityScope Onboarding

ParityScope crawls partner hotel rates across the Tindlemere booking feeds and flags mismatches against contracted floors. New hires: read the scraper etiquette doc first. Alerts route to the rates channel; anything over a five percent drift pages the rotation. Local setup takes ten minutes with the bootstrap script. Your first task is restoring the seed database from the sealed backup, which requires the passphrase given below.

unlock words, hahif-yahag: novath-druir-fenys-lamael-julath-oliox-soriel-quenax-briiel-druius-juleth-gordor-druok

## Step 3: Pin the Component Library Version

As of Brindlewick UI v4, shared components no longer float on the latest minor release. Each consuming app must pin an exact version in its manifest before upgrading. Skipping this step causes mismatched theme tokens at build time. Update your manifest to match the values below, then rerun the bundler.

deployment values, tahaf-fajog:
[ralmir]
host = ralmir.paliqcorp.internal
user = ralmir_svc
database = ralmir_prod

## Step 2: Propagate trace context

Plugins targeting Larkspur 3.x must forward the trace header on every downstream call. Drop any custom span naming; the Quillgate collector now derives names from route templates. Sampling decisions happen upstream — do not override them. Your plugin inherits the tracing settings shown in the following block.

deployment values, yadug-bawif:
[framir]
team = pelox
access_code = ac_a38ab2
owner = tamion.julael
host = framir.tolvaqlabs.test
port = 11211
peer = tammir.zemvargrid.local
salt = 2215ef03
pin = 1541

Handover: Exportron retry queue

Hi Mira — handing over the failed-export retries. Exports that hit a timeout land in the retry queue and get three attempts with backoff; after that they're parked and need a manual requeue from the admin panel. Watch for customers reporting duplicates — that usually means a double requeue. The current retry settings are as follows.

settings of bajog-fawig:
oliael:
  log_level: warn
  metrics_host: metrics.oliael.zemvarsys.internal
  pin: 0267
  pool_size: 32